January 17Make Good Choices

If a person has a genuine, sincere, hearty wish to get rid of their liberty, if they are really bent upon becoming a slave, nothing can stop them. And the temptation is to some natures a very great one. Liberty is often a heavy burden on a person. It involves that necessity for perpetual choice which is the kind of labor people have always dreaded. In common life we shirk it by forming habits, which take the place of self-determination.

Oliver Wendell Holmes, Sr.—Elsie Venner: A Romance of Destiny (1861)

Owning a business, being an entrepreneur, is either the most freeing perspective available or it's not at all. But the good news is you get to choose.

If you don't feel free at all right now, consider what well-worn justifications you might be using to keep yourself in chains. If only x wasn't a problem, I would finally do y.

It doesn't mean there aren't substantial constraints to your ability to do what you were destined to do—it simply demonstrates that resistance is a strong force.

Deciding to overcome resistance is your most momentous choice. Often it's a choice that involves fear, drama, and courage, and it's also often one many won't make unless pushed, because the habit of justification is too ferocious.

The secret to making the choice that is right for you is to stop living in either the future or the past and to embrace fear as something you can accept in today's version of freedom.
